  • Richwood, New Jersey Census Data
  • The total number of people in Richwood is 57. Of those, 29 are Male (50.88 %) and 28 are Female (49.12 %).

    In Richwood, New Jersey 39.3 is the median age.

    Richwood, New Jersey population is broken down (as a percentage) by age as follows:

    Under Age of 5: 3.51 %
    Ages 5 to 9: 8.77 %
    Ages 10 to 14: 12.28 %
    Ages 15 to 19: 5.26 %
    Ages 20 to 24: 5.26 %
    Ages 25 to 34: 12.28 %
    Ages 35 to 44: 12.28 %
    Ages 45 to 54: 19.30 %
    Ages 55 to 59: 1.75 %
    Ages 60 to 64: 5.26 %
    Ages 65 to 74: 8.77 %
    Ages 75 to 84: 1.75 %
    Over the age of 85: 3.51 %

    Richwood Statistical Data
    Richwood, New Jersey Total Area covers 0.28 Square Miles.
    Total Water Area is 0.00 Square Miles.
    Total Land Area is 0.28 Square Miles.
    In Richwood, NJ. pop. density is 200.44 persons/square mile.
    Richwood, New Jersey is located in the Eastern (GMT -5) Time Zone.
    The elevation in Richwood is 57 Ft.

Tapering off drug or alcohol use can help somewhat to minimize withdrawal symptoms, but for many people, especially those that abuse highly addictive drugs for a long duration of time, it simply may not be feasible to do that. The drug addiction or alcoholism can simply have progressed too far and the impulse to use a drug or alcohol has grown to be too powerful. In such situations, an alcohol or drug detox facility is the most effective route to getting through the withdrawal process. Most drug rehab and alcohol rehabilitation programs offer a medical detox to treat withdrawal symptoms that are brought on by the abrupt discontinuation of drug or alcohol use so that the sometimes unpleasant withdrawal process can be made more pleasant for the client. Discontinuing the use of addictive drugs and alcohol employing the cold turkey approach is not recommended because it can occasionally bring about life-threatening withdrawal symptoms, such as seizures and convulsions.

Some of the indicators of drug addiction or alcoholism include inadequate school or job attendance and performance, unhealthy physical appearance, significant weight loss or gain, unusual sleeping habits, isolating from friends and family, neglecting responsibilities, financial issues, anger and hostility toward family, withdrawal symptoms when the drug or alcohol is not obtainable, cravings and the desire to get hold of the drug or alcohol despite the consequences including but not limited to lying and stealing to get it. If any of these addiction indicators are apparent in yourself or someone close to you, it is very probable that you have an addiction problem and would benefit significantly from the effective services of a drug and alcohol rehabilitation program to recover from it.
